摘要

The NCTU PCU-3-02 10-megapixel 4K2K (max. 4160x2464) LCoS panels with LCM-I107 nematic LC were assembled and evaluated. The results of both 1.2-inch 4K2K (-4,000 PPI) amplitude type LCoS microdisplay and 0.7-inch 4K2K (~7,000 PPI) phase-only type LCoS spatial light modulator (SLM) can achieve 1~2 ms response time at T=45 °C. Meanwhile, the phase linearity, precision and accuracy of 4K2K LCoSSLM were assessed in this work. These new LCoS schemes will potentially be utilized in color-sequential, holographic, virtual and augmented reality display.
